12. Tiwa Savage and Dr SID on stage at the Mavins UK concert in 2014.
Page 2 of 15
12. Tiwa Savage and Dr SID on stage at the Mavins UK concert in 2014.
Your best source for noteworthy updates. Designed by WebAndName.
Your best source for noteworthy updates. Designed by WebAndName.
Discussion about this post